public class TileSource<T extends TileSourceInfo>
extends java.lang.Object
构造器和说明 |
---|
TileSource() |
限定符和类型 | 方法和说明 |
---|---|
void |
addAvailableListener(RemoteTileSourceAvailableListener listener) |
void |
addChangedListener(RemoteTileSourceChangedListener listener) |
boolean |
connect(T tileSourceInfo)
连接切片源。
|
boolean |
disConnect()
断开连接。
|
static java.util.List<java.lang.Class<?>> |
extendedTileSourceProviders() |
TileSourceProvider<T> |
getProvider() |
Tileset<?,?> |
getTileset(MetaData expectMetaData, boolean createIfNotExist)
返回兼容给定元信息的切片集
|
Tileset<?,?> |
getTileset(java.lang.String name) |
Tileset<?,?>[] |
getTilesets()
已过时。
|
Tileset<?,?>[] |
getTilesets(TilesetQueryParameter parameter)
根据查询参数返回切片集。
|
int |
getTilesetsCount(TilesetQueryParameter parameter)
根据查询参数返回切片集数量。
|
T |
getTileSourceInfo() |
boolean |
isConnected() |
void |
refresh()
刷新切片源。
|
void |
removeAvailableListener(RemoteTileSourceAvailableListener listener) |
void |
removeChangedListener(RemoteTileSourceChangedListener listener) |
public static java.util.List<java.lang.Class<?>> extendedTileSourceProviders()
public boolean connect(T tileSourceInfo)
tileSourceInfo
-public TileSourceProvider<T> getProvider()
public void addAvailableListener(RemoteTileSourceAvailableListener listener)
public void addChangedListener(RemoteTileSourceChangedListener listener)
public void removeAvailableListener(RemoteTileSourceAvailableListener listener)
public void removeChangedListener(RemoteTileSourceChangedListener listener)
public boolean disConnect()
@Deprecated public Tileset<?,?>[] getTilesets()
public Tileset<?,?>[] getTilesets(TilesetQueryParameter parameter)
parameter
- 查询参数public int getTilesetsCount(TilesetQueryParameter parameter)
parameter
- 查询参数public void refresh()
public T getTileSourceInfo()
public Tileset<?,?> getTileset(MetaData expectMetaData, boolean createIfNotExist)
返回兼容给定元信息的切片集
expectMetaData
-createIfNotExist不存在时,是否创建切片集
-public Tileset<?,?> getTileset(java.lang.String name)
public boolean isConnected()